RPG Maker MV终极插件指南:500+免费插件打造专业级游戏体验
【免费下载链接】RPGMakerMVRPGツクールMV、MZで動作するプラグインです。项目地址: https://gitcode.com/gh_mirrors/rp/RPGMakerMV
RPG Maker MV是一款广受欢迎的游戏制作工具,但其原生功能往往难以满足专业开发需求。今天,我将为你介绍一个包含500+免费插件的开源宝库,让你无需编程就能突破引擎限制,打造主机级游戏体验。这个RPGMakerMV插件集为开发者提供了从地图渲染到战斗系统、从UI美化到性能优化的全方位解决方案,真正实现了零代码专业游戏开发。
核心优势:为什么选择这个插件库?
1. 完整的视觉增强方案
这个华丽的宫殿场景展示了ParallaxLayerMap.js插件的强大能力。通过多层视差技术,你可以创建具有深度感的动态地图环境。传统的RPG Maker MV地图往往显得平面化,而这个插件库提供了真正的立体视觉解决方案。
基础层作为地图的核心结构,为复杂的视觉效果奠定了基础。通过将场景分解为多个独立图层,每个图层都可以单独控制透明度、位置和移动速度,从而实现真正的立体感。
2. 零代码实现专业效果
与需要JavaScript编程知识的传统插件不同,这个插件库的设计理念是"配置即实现"。你只需要在RPG Maker编辑器中启用插件并设置参数,就能获得专业级的游戏功能。例如:
- 地图系统:ParallaxLayerMap.js允许无限图层视差地图
- 战斗系统:AttackChain.js实现连击机制
- 界面美化:WindowBackImage.js自定义窗口背景
- 性能优化:PerformanceRefine.js自动优化资源加载
3. 双版本兼容性
插件同时支持RPG Maker MV和MZ两个版本,无论你使用哪个版本,都能找到适合的解决方案。这种兼容性确保了项目的长期可维护性。
实战应用:5大场景快速上手
场景一:创建动态宫殿地图
使用ParallaxLayerMap.js创建专业级地图只需3步:
- 准备基础地图:在RPG Maker中创建基础布局
- 启用视差插件:在插件管理器启用ParallaxLayerMap.js
- 配置图层参数:通过事件注释控制透明度、混合模式和位置偏移
// 示例配置 <PLM:para_samplemap1> <PLM_Opacity:200> <PLM_Blend:0>场景二:优化战斗系统体验
战斗是RPG游戏的核心,插件库提供了完整的战斗增强方案:
- BattleLogSpeed.js:自定义战斗日志显示速度
- StateEffect.js:为状态效果添加视觉动画
- SkillSuccessRatePlus.js:可视化技能成功率显示
- AttackChain.js:实现连击系统
这些插件可以单独使用,也可以组合应用,为你的战斗系统增加深度和策略性。
场景三:美化用户界面
WindowBackImage.js插件允许你为每个游戏窗口设置自定义背景。从标题画面到战斗界面,从菜单系统到对话窗口,你可以完全自定义整个游戏的视觉风格。
支持自定义背景的窗口包括:
- Window_Message(消息窗口)
- Window_MenuCommand(菜单命令窗口)
- Window_BattleLog(战斗日志窗口)
- Window_ShopCommand(商店命令窗口)
场景四:提升移动设备体验
针对手机和平板玩家,插件库提供了专门的优化方案:
- TouchActionThere.js:优化触屏操作精度
- VirtualButtonCommand.js:添加虚拟按键支持
- MousePointerExtend.js:自定义指针样式
- ScreenRotation.js:支持屏幕旋转适配
场景五:性能优化与兼容性
确保游戏在各种设备上流畅运行:
- PerformanceRefine.js:自动优化资源加载和渲染流程
- AutoSaveDisable.js:禁用自动保存,避免游戏卡顿
- FixImageLoading.js:修复图片加载问题
- BugFixWebPlayTest.js:修复网页版测试的常见问题
技术深度:插件架构解析
模块化设计理念
插件库采用高度模块化的设计,每个插件都专注于解决特定问题。这种设计理念带来了几个重要优势:
- 低耦合性:插件之间相互独立,可以按需组合使用
- 易于维护:单个插件的更新不会影响其他功能
- 灵活配置:开发者可以根据项目需求选择最合适的插件组合
事件驱动系统
许多插件基于RPG Maker MV的事件系统构建,通过事件注释和插件命令实现功能扩展。例如:
- 使用事件注释控制视差图层参数
- 通过插件命令触发特殊效果
- 利用变量和开关实现条件逻辑
资源管理优化
插件库包含多个资源管理相关的插件,帮助开发者更高效地处理游戏资源:
- CharacterGraphicManager.js:角色图形资源管理
- PictureGrouping.js:图片分组管理
- AudioCache.js:音频缓存优化
快速开始指南
获取插件库
git clone https://gitcode.com/gh_mirrors/rp/RPGMakerMV插件安装步骤
- 选择插件:浏览插件目录,选择适合你项目的插件
- 复制文件:将插件文件复制到RPG Maker项目的
js/plugins目录 - 启用配置:在RPG Maker编辑器中启用插件并配置参数
- 测试验证:运行游戏测试插件功能
推荐入门插件组合
对于新手开发者,建议从以下组合开始:
- 基础优化:PerformanceRefine.js + AutoSaveDisable.js
- 界面美化:MessageSpeedCustomize.js + SaveFileDrawFace.js
- 功能扩展:ParallaxLayerMap.js + BattleLayoutClassic.js
进阶技巧:插件组合应用
专业战斗系统组合
想要创建独特的战斗体验?试试这个专业组合:
- BattleLogSpeed.js:调整战斗节奏
- StateEffect.js:添加状态动画效果
- SkillSuccessRatePlus.js:可视化技能成功率
- AttackChain.js:实现连击机制
移动设备优化方案
针对手机玩家,这个组合能大幅提升体验:
- TouchActionThere.js:优化触屏操作精度
- VirtualButtonCommand.js:添加虚拟按键
- MousePointerExtend.js:自定义指针样式
- ScreenRotation.js:支持屏幕旋转
视觉特效增强方案
创建动态天气和光影效果:
- ParallaxLayerMap.js:多层视差基础
- CharacterGraphicExtend.js:角色动画扩展
- AnimationExtend.js:特效动画增强
- PerformanceRefine.js:性能保障
资源与学习路径
官方文档与示例
- 插件使用指南:ReadMe/目录下的详细说明文档
- 视差地图示例:Sample/sample_parallax/文件夹中的完整实现
- 示例代码:SampleCode.js提供基础使用示例
学习路径建议
如果你是RPG Maker新手,建议按照以下顺序学习:
- 基础阶段:从PerformanceRefine.js和AutoSaveDisable.js开始
- 界面美化:学习MessageSpeedCustomize.js和SaveFileDrawFace.js
- 功能扩展:尝试ParallaxLayerMap.js和BattleLayoutClassic.js
- 高级定制:组合使用多个插件,创造独特的游戏机制
常见问题解决方案
问题:游戏运行卡顿
- 解决方案:启用PerformanceRefine.js插件
问题:地图缺乏层次感
- 解决方案:使用ParallaxLayerMap.js创建多层视差效果
问题:战斗系统单调
- 解决方案:组合使用AttackChain.js、StateEffect.js和SkillSuccessRatePlus.js插件
项目特色与优势
完全开源免费
基于MIT许可证,你可以自由使用、修改甚至重新分发这些插件。无论是商业项目还是个人作品,都没有任何限制!
持续更新维护
项目由活跃的开发者社区维护,定期修复bug并添加新功能。这意味着你的游戏总能获得最新的优化和改进。
完善的技术文档
每个插件都有详细的使用说明,配合丰富的示例项目,即使是完全的新手也能快速上手。
社区支持
拥有活跃的用户社区,你可以在遇到问题时获得及时的帮助和支持。
开始你的专业游戏开发之旅
现在,你已经了解了RPGMakerMV插件集的强大功能。想象一下,你的游戏将拥有:
- 华丽的动态地图效果:通过多层视差实现立体感
- 深度丰富的战斗系统:连击、状态特效、智能AI一应俱全
- 流畅美观的用户界面:自定义窗口、弹窗消息、虚拟按键
- 优秀的跨平台性能:优化后的代码确保在各种设备上流畅运行
这一切都不需要你编写一行代码!只需下载插件、简单配置,就能获得专业级的游戏开发工具。
记住,优秀的游戏不仅仅是代码和美术的堆砌,更是创意与工具的结合。RPGMakerMV插件集为你提供了实现创意的工具,而创意本身——永远掌握在你的手中。
立即行动:从Sample/sample_parallax/示例开始,亲手创建一个多层视差地图。这是理解插件工作原理的最佳方式,也是迈向专业游戏开发的第一步。
专业提示:建议先从简单的插件开始,如PerformanceRefine.js和AutoSaveDisable.js,熟悉插件使用方法后再尝试更复杂的功能组合。记住,循序渐进是最好的学习方式!
从今天起,让你的RPG游戏不再"业余",而是真正的主机级体验!
【免费下载链接】RPGMakerMVRPGツクールMV、MZで動作するプラグインです。项目地址: https://gitcode.com/gh_mirrors/rp/RPGMakerMV
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考